Subject: Quickstore 4.2 — bloom filter now fronts the KV layer

Plugin authors: starting with this release, Quickstore places a bloom filter ahead of the key-value store. Negative lookups return faster; false positives fall through safely. No API changes are required on your side. Verify your plugin against the staging build referenced below.

session token of fahif-tadup = htk3_9c7

Excerpt from the Fennick dedup design. Candidate customer pairs are generated via salted blocking keys, then scored by the Oriole matcher; no raw identifiers leave the enclave. Merges above the auto-threshold are logged with reversible tombstones, and borderline pairs queue for manual review with field-level redaction. Security reviewers should verify the threshold choices against re-identification risk. Current matcher constants follow.

tuning constants:
QUOTAS = {
    "druwyn": 5,
    "holix": 5,
    "zorath": 5,
    "holwyn": 10,
}

# Runbook: Hunting leaked file descriptors in Quillgate

When the `fd_open` gauge climbs steadily between deploys, suspect a leak rather than load. First confirm on a single pod: exec in and count entries under `/proc/1/fd`, noting how many are sockets in CLOSE_WAIT versus regular files. Capture two snapshots ten minutes apart before restarting anything — we need the delta for the postmortem. Reproduce locally with the Marbury load harness, which requires the service running with the following configuration values.

settings of yagep-bajog:
[istdor]
port = 4000
region = south-2
host = istdor.qorvelcorp.internal
timeout_ms = 5000
retries = 5

Finance Review Summary — Brightlake Outdoor Gear

Quick read for the sales leads: the freeze on hiring in the Western Retail division stays in place for now. Payroll there ran 9% over plan, and the Hollowpine store rollout ate more cash than expected. Good news — commissions and existing headcount aren't touched, and the freeze doesn't apply to your teams. We'll revisit after the spring numbers close. Reach out to Dara in FP&A with edge cases. The confidential planning note follows directly below.

internal memo for yahof-bajop: Tamethox Group is in early talks to buy Ulamirek Group for about $64.0 million. The Aldiel launch date is October 11, and nothing goes to the press before then.